Understanding Your Needs: Types of Coffee Machines
Before diving into particular designs, it's vital to understand the different kinds of coffee machines readily available in the market. Each type serves unique purposes and caters to different preferences.
| Kind Of Coffee Machine | Best For | Secret Features |
|---|---|---|
| Drip Coffee Maker | Workplaces, dining establishments | Easy to utilize, brews big amounts, affordable |
| Espresso Machines | Cafés, specialized coffee stores | Rich tastes, versatile, requires skill |
| Coffee Pods/Capsule | Quick service environments | Practical, minimal cleanup, restricted options |
| French Press | Small offices, homes | Affordable, full-bodied coffee, manual procedure |
| Single-Serve Machines | On-the-go people | Quick brewing, no waste, less space required |
| Automatic Coffee Machines | Medium to big workplaces | Programmable settings, integrated grinders, simple maintenance |
Secret Features to Consider
When purchasing a coffee machine, it's important to try to find functions that fit your operational needs. Here are some of the most crucial factors:
Capacity: The size of the machine is directly proportional to the variety of cups it can brew in one cycle. For organizations with high coffee consumption, larger machines or multi-pot makers may be necessary.
Brew Time: Rapid brew time can be vital throughout peak hours. Look for machines that provide a fast developing cycle, especially in busy settings.
Personalization: Many contemporary coffee machines enable customization in terms of strength, temperature level, and volume, dealing with varied customer choices.
Reduce of Use: Training personnel is vital, so select user-friendly machines with intuitive controls.
Upkeep: Cleaning and upkeep are important for keeping the coffee machine operating efficiently. Some machines come with self-cleaning features that can conserve time and effort.
Expense: Prices for coffee machines can vary wildly. It's necessary to set a budget before exploring alternatives.
Brand name Reputation: Research suggestions and reviews of numerous brands, as credibility can considerably impact toughness and consumer complete satisfaction.

Aspects Impacting Your Decision
When choosing a coffee machine, it is essential to consider these extra aspects:
Location: The available area will dictate the size and kind of machine right for your company. Think about countertop space, shelving, and electrical outlets.
Employee Input: Engaging your staff in the decision can promote a sense of ownership and guarantee you accommodate their choices.
Type of Coffee You Serve: If your brand name leans towards espresso-based drinks, buying a high-end espresso machine may yield much better returns.
Future Expansion: Consider possible development. Invest in a machine that can manage increased demand without compromising quality.
Customer Satisfaction: Ultimately, happy clients return. Having the right coffee machine can boost the overall consumer experience considerably.
Frequently asked questions
1. How much should I invest in a coffee machine for my company?
Prices can vary dramatically based on functions and capabilities. Smaller sized setups might discover machines in the ₤ 100-₤ 300 range enough, while bigger operations might need machines costing ₤ 600 and up.
2. How often should I preserve my coffee machine?
Routine maintenance is needed to make sure longevity. This can vary from daily cleaning of parts to month-to-month deep cleaning. Always describe the manufacturer's standards.
3. What type of coffee machine is best for a high-traffic environment?
For high-traffic environments, think about machines that can brew rapidly and serve multiple cups, like drip coffee machine or high-capacity espresso machines.
4. Can I utilize my own coffee in a pod machine?
Many pod machines need exclusive pods, but some designs enable reusable pods where you can use your coffee grounds.
5. What features should I focus on if budget is restricted?
If spending plan is a concern, prioritize machines with resilient construction and outstanding brewing abilities over extra functions like programmability or integrated grinders.
